For those concerned about "poaching," check out the html code for 
Loglan.org and lojban.org. Note that the content meta tags for 
lojban.org do not mention Loglan, while those for Loglan.org do mention 
lojban! The purpose of the meta content tag is to help people find us 
with google and other search engines. There is absolutely nothing wrong 
with putting "Loglan" in the content list for lojban.org. I guess that 
is why lojban gets no higher than 13th on google, while the first 12 
hits are all Loglan sites.
